Output 852813255fa7186dca3f536077061065511570c0e9082133ba18cebb008ce495:5

value
1089198
script pubkey
OP_0 OP_PUSHBYTES_20 ecf78c014ce20ef30936f8cfecf8e007a2b11d3e
address
bc1qanmccq2vug80xzfklr87e78qq73tz8f7979phq
transaction
852813255fa7186dca3f536077061065511570c0e9082133ba18cebb008ce495
spent
true